Limitless silanes

Silane coupling agents have the unique chemical and physical properties to not only enhance bond strength, but also prevent de-bonding at the interface due to use and aging, especially in humid conditions. The coupling agent provides a stable bond between two otherwise poorly bonding surfaces.

Silane Coupling Agent

Silane coupling agents are primarily used in reinforced plastics and electric cables composed of crosslinked polyethylene. Other uses include resins, concrete, sealant primers, paint, adhesives, printing inks and dyeing auxiliaries.

2. Performance Characteristics of Amino Silane Coupling Agents

Amino silane coupling agents exhibit exceptional physicochemical properties, enabling their widespread use across industries. Key advantages include:

  • High Adhesion and Surface Activity: They significantly strengthen interfacial bonding in materials.
  • Chemical Bond Stability: They form robust bonds that improve temperature resistance, weatherability, and corrosion resistance.
  • Low Surface Energy and Lubrication: These traits make them indispensable in high-performance applications, such as coatings, adhesives, and sealants, where they enhance overall product durability and reliability.

3. Applications Across Diverse Industries

Amino silane coupling agents find versatile uses in construction, automotive, electronics, textiles, and more:

  • Construction: Used in waterproof coatings and sealants to prevent moisture penetration and extend building lifespan.
  • Automotive: Added to automotive coatings to boost abrasion and corrosion resistance.
  • Electronics: Employed in high-performance adhesives and sealants to ensure operational stability of devices.
  • Textiles: Integrated into fabric treatments to impart water repellency and stain resistance.
